About the Role:

The CrowdStrike Services Internship Program is a 12-week full-time summer internship that provides individuals with experience across all major aspects of the CrowdStrike Services business, with a focus on red teaming.

What You’ll Need:

  • Be towards a BA or BS / MA or MS deg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science/Engineering, Math, Information Security, Information Systems, Information Assurance, Information Security Management, Intelligence Studies, Data Science or other related field.

  • Be a rising Junior/Senior (if pursuing an undergraduate degree)

  • Be scheduled to graduate after August 2023

From a technical perspective, it is desired (but not required) that candidates:

  • Security community participation (contributing to open-source tooling, content creation including blogs and writeups)

  • Experience with Security Assessment Toolsets (Metasploit, NMAP, Cobalt Strike, Nessus, Burp Suite, etc.)

  • Experience with capture the flag events and cyber security competitions (CCDC, Cyber Patriot, U.S. Cyber Challenge)

  • Desirable Certifications: OSCP, GPEN, OSCE, GCIH, GXPN

  • Familiarity with Windows / Linux / UNIX / Mac operating systems

  • Experience in scripting and programming

  • Familiarity with networking / OSI model

  • Understanding of security methodologies, technologies, and best practices

  • A rigorous, world-leading red team operator course built especially for our CrowdStrike red team interns delivered by subject matter experts right across the division, covering many aspects of red teaming at CrowdStrike, including:

    • Engagement Shadowing:

      • Exposure to all types of red team engagements via shadowing active operations

      • View TTPs used by the red team

      • Interact with the engagement’s project manager and consultants throughout each engagement

      • Learn the basics of Consulting and project management skills

  • Simulated Red Team Engagement

    • Manage a mock red team engagement

    • Conduct testing against a lab environment to identify multiple security vulnerabilities and misconfigurations

    • Present findings to red team mentors in simulated client interactions

  • Project Development

    • Work with the red team’s development team to identify a project to complete during your internship

    • Identified project will support the red team in the form of tooling or process improvement

    • Dedicated time will be allocated for creation, testing, and demonstrating the projects capabilities or improvements
